George J. Ruff, Russell, Kansas - 86, died Wednesday, Dec. 4, 1974, at Russell City Hospital. Born March 12, 1888, in Dietel, Russia, he married Ida Gunther, July 5, 1911, at Russell. He was a retired real-estate agent and lived here most of his life. He was a member of the Trinity United Methodist Church, Russell.
Survivors are the widow; son, Eugene, Kansas City; daughter: Mrs. Clifton Pangburn, Corona Del Mar, Calif.; sister, Mrs. Sophia Wolf, Russell; six grandchildren; four great-grandchildren.
Funeral will be 10:30am Friday at the church; Rev. Richard Robbins. Burial will be in Russell City Cemetery. Pohlman's Mortuary, Russell.
